    One dead, several hospitalised in Mahaicony accident

    The Police in ‘C’ Division are investigating a fatal accident that took place on the Mahaicony Public Road at about 11:00 hours on Wednesday, November 30, 2016.

    Dead is Esme Rockcliffe of Le Enterprise, Mahaicony, East Coast Demerara who is believed to be in her late 50s.

    The News Room understands that the accident involves two minibuses and a motor car which was allegedly travelling at a fast rate.

    Although information on the accident is still sketchy, News Room was told that four females and four males sustained serious injuries. The females were rushed to the Georgetown Public Hospital where Rockliffe succumbed.

    The males; one of whom is a driver of one of the minibuses were admitted to the Mahaicony Cottage Hospital.

    According to a source, three of the injured persons are nationals of Trinidad, Grenada and St. Vincent who are currently pursuing studies at the University of Guyana.

    More details on this latest road accident will be provided as it becomes available.
